Output 278561fd703ae766f73eea7e2dfa964bfaf1e320baad24d293f7a00605eb91e4:2

value
1051843
script pubkey
OP_0 OP_PUSHBYTES_20 16ec362fe687d998150d9d6adcbc90b06a05283c
address
ltc1qzmkrvtlxslves9gdn44de0yskp4q22pu0ewssl
transaction
278561fd703ae766f73eea7e2dfa964bfaf1e320baad24d293f7a00605eb91e4
spent
true